在应用程序卸载时不会清除LocalStorage - Android 6

ale*_*e.m 8 local-storage angularjs cordova ionic-framework

我有一个问题,当我卸载应用程序(离子应用程序)时,localstorage不会被清除.它只发生在我的带有Android 6的三星S7 Edge上(至少是我唯一拥有Android 6的设备).

清除它的唯一方法是通过设备的应用程序管理器清除数据/缓存...

它在其他设备上正常工作......由于本地存储实现非常简单,我不知道为什么会发生这种情况......

有任何想法吗?

Sag*_*rni 11

Android 6具有自动备份功能.

您是否尝试在manifest.xml中设置android:allowBackup ="false"android:fullBackupContent ="false"

android:allowBackupandroid:fullBackupContent<application/>应用程序的manifest.xml 中的属性.

在离子2中,您也可以在platforms文件夹下找到它.如果您不希望备份数据,或者想要包含或排除某些资源,则可以使用这些属性.

我也在联想Vibe手机上挣扎了很长时间.这解决了它.